How Chiropractic Care Can Aid in Injury Recovery and Pain Relief

Chiropractors are renowned for their ability to help injured athletes return to their sport quickly and safely. They use drug-free, natural therapies to reduce inflammation and strengthen tissues in order to accelerate the healing process. They also work to correct spinal misalignments that limit flexibility and reduce range of motion, which can hinder sports performance and increase the risk of injury.

In addition to spinal adjustments, chiropractors also employ various soft tissue techniques, such as massage and myofascial release, to ease tight muscles and break down scar tissue that can form as a result of injury. They may also perform a technique called Flexion-Distraction therapy, which uses a special table to move the spine carefully, creating space and easing pressure on the affected areas, thus speeding up the healing process.

Depending on the nature of the injury, a chiropractic doctor might use a range of therapeutic modalities, such as cold or hot packs to reduce inflammation and swelling, ultrasound, or electrical muscle stimulation to stimulate blood flow and reduce pain and stiffness. They might also suggest rehabilitation exercises to improve strength and stability, which can prevent future injuries.

For example, they might recommend specific stretches and exercise to promote flexibility and prevent the tightening of muscles that can restrict movement and lead to poor posture. Lastly, they might recommend nutritional and dietary advice that can help to reduce inflammation and support healing.
